Introduction to the Magic Eraser

Before diving into the lifespan of a Magic Eraser, it’s essential to understand what it is and how it works. The Magic Eraser is a type of cleaning pad made from a material called melamine foam. This foam is microporous, meaning it has tiny pores that can lift and remove dirt and stains from surfaces. The melamine foam is non-abrasive, making it safe to use on a wide range of surfaces, including walls, countertops, and even some types of flooring.

How long does a Magic Eraser typically last?

The lifespan of a Magic Eraser depends on various factors, including usage frequency, cleaning surface type, and eraser maintenance. On average, a Magic Eraser can last anywhere from a few weeks to several months. If used daily for heavy-duty cleaning tasks, the eraser may need to be replaced every 2-4 weeks. However, if used occasionally for light cleaning tasks, it can last up to 3-6 months. It’s essential to monitor the eraser’s condition and replace it when it becomes worn out or less effective.

To extend the lifespan of a Magic Eraser, it’s crucial to rinse it thoroughly after each use and allow it to dry completely. This helps prevent the buildup of dirt and debris, which can reduce the eraser’s effectiveness. Additionally, avoiding the use of the Magic Eraser on rough or abrasive surfaces can help prevent wear and tear. By following these simple tips, you can maximize the lifespan of your Magic Eraser and ensure it continues to provide effective cleaning results.
